Add verify and merge jobs for ran-simulator 60/113060/2
authorNiranjana <niranjana.y60@wipro.com>
Wed, 23 Sep 2020 12:40:08 +0000 (18:10 +0530)
committerNiranjana <niranjana.y60@wipro.com>
Wed, 23 Sep 2020 13:07:42 +0000 (18:37 +0530)
Issue-ID: INT-1725
Signed-off-by: Niranjana <niranjana.y60@wipro.com>
Change-Id: I76fc86afb412c5981d86a437e2d4ce6c44d96c6d

jjb/integration/simulators/integration-ran-simulator.yaml

index 895854a..aea005d 100644 (file)
@@ -1,4 +1,30 @@
 ---
+- project:
+      name: integration-simulators-ran-simulator
+      project-name: integration-simulators-ran-simulator
+      stream:
+          -   'master':
+                  branch: 'master'
+      project: 'integration/simulators/ran-simulator'
+      mvn-settings: 'integration-simulators-ran-simulator-settings'
+      files: '**'
+      maven-deploy-properties: |
+          deployAtEnd=true
+      archive-artifacts: ''
+      build-node: ubuntu1804-docker-8c-8g
+      jobs:
+          - '{project-name}-{stream}-verify-java':
+                mvn-goals: 'clean install'
+          - '{project-name}-{stream}-merge-java':
+                mvn-goals: 'clean deploy'
+          -  '{project-name}-gerrit-release-jobs':
+                 build-node: centos7-docker-8c-8g
+          - gerrit-maven-stage:
+                sign-artifacts: true
+                build-node: centos7-docker-8c-8g
+                maven-versions-plugin: true
+                mvn-goals: 'clean deploy'
+
 - project:
     name: integration-simulators-ran-simulator-info
     project-name: integration-simulators-ran-simulator